Handing off the Quillbus broker upgrade (4.x to 5.1) to Dario. Cluster is half-migrated; mixed-version mode is supported but TLS cert rotation must finish before cutover. No auth model changes, though the admin API gained two new endpoints worth reviewing. Open questions and the migration checklist are tracked on the internal page below.

dashboard of taduf-bawef = https://jira.lumicsys.internal/projects/display/browse/b1cbf89d

**14:22 — Payroll export format change lands.** Heads up, plugin folks: this is where things went sideways. The Ledgerline team shipped a new column order in the payroll CSV export without bumping the schema version, so anything parsing by position broke quietly. Downstream plugins started writing wages into the tax-code field. We caught it about forty minutes later via the Quillmont reconciliation job. The offending build is identified by the token below.

build token for kagaf-hahof: htk14_9d3d4d26d7d8de

**Q: I lost access to my ShrinkRay plugin signing account. How do I recover it?**

Run `shrinkray auth recover` from the same machine you registered on. The CLI checks your local keystore, then asks for the plugin registry passphrase. Batch jobs pause until recovery completes; queued resizes resume automatically. Don't regenerate your keystore — that invalidates published plugins. The passphrase the prompt expects is:

strongbox words: zordor-quenax